Beaver, Mary (1852 - 11 May 1925)

Mary Domine was born at Trier, Germany in 1852 and died on Monday May 11, 1925 at the Marshfield Hospital. She came with her parents to this country when a year old. On July 17, 1872 she was married to John Beaver at Jefferson, Wis., where they lived until 43 years ago, when they moved to Clark County, Wis. Mr. and Mrs. Beaver settled in what was then a wilderness, three and one half miles southeast of this village, and which they made into one of the finest farms in the county. Seven years ago they moved to the village where they have since resided.

To this union was born 19 children, 7 daughters and 12 sons, seventeen of whom grew to manhood and womanhood. Fourteen are now living, along with the husband mourn the loss of a loving wife and mother. She was devoted to her home and family and will be greatly missed in the home circle and by her friends and neighbors.

In 1922 Mr. and Mrs. Beaver celebrated their golden wedding and all their children were home for this event. The following are the names of the children: George Beaver, Granton, Mrs. Mike Duvall, Marshfield, Mrs. Peter Schmitz, Orcutt, Calif., Mrs. Frank Bauer, Mrs. Joseph Wedl, Mike, Nick, William, Frank, Edward, Phillip, Peter, Bernard and Matt, all of Loyal. She also leaves 48 grandchildren and 9 great-grandchildren, besides a sister, Mrs. John Paulus and other relatives.

The funeral service was held at St. Balthasar's Catholic Church on Thursday with Solemn Requiem High Mass, Rev. Joseph F. Stenz as celebrant, assisted by Rev. John Novak and Rev. S. Frye. She was laid to rest in the Catholic Cemetery.
